How to root ASUS Zenfone 2 Z008/Z00A on Android Lollipop [Guide]

Asus Zenfone 2The ASUS Zenfone 2 sounds like it might be old since we know of other Zenfone numbers that are higher. However, this is a new smartphone that runs Android 5.0 Lollipop out of the box. If you are running Lollipop and would like to know how to get root access to unchain the system internals, read the guide after the drop. Here’s how to root ASUS Zenfone 2 on Android Lollipop:

REQUIREMENTS

You need to have the Zenfone 2 and not any other variant of  Zenfone. Furthermore, we only recommend following this guide for Android 5.0 Lollipop users. The current exploit might be patched in future software updates which means you might need to find a new rooting method.

BEFORE WE BEGIN

  • Download the ASUS USB Drivers to your computer. You need to reboot the Windows PC after installing the ASUS drivers to get them working.
  • Enable the Zenfone USB Debugging Mode by heading to Settings > Developer Options > USB Debugging. Those of you who cannot find the Developer Options probably must unlock the hidden menu by heading to Settings > About Device > tap the build number seven times.
  • You are voiding the warranty by following this guide. Try downloading a stock firmware to unroot and gain the warranty back.

HOW TO ROOT ASUS ZENFONE 2 ON ANDROID LOLLIPOP

  1. Download fastboot to the desktop of the computer.
  2. Download the pre-rooted image. Look for the model number of yours and click the corresponding link from that page.
  3. Extract both files above to the desktop of the computer so you can use the files inside. All you need to do is right-click the mouse over the zipped file and select the extract option.
  4. Move the mouse to inside the Fastboot folder and right-click and hold down the Shift key on an empty white space. You should get a new menu popping up. Select to open the command prompt from that new menu.
  5. Type the first command: “adb reboot-bootloader”.
  6. Rename the system image to “system.img”. You find that image inside the other folder that isn’t Fastboot.
  7. Type the second command: “fastboot flash system system.img”
  8. Type the final command after the earlier one finishes: “fastboot reboot”

Now you have the root access you desire and the Zenfone smartphone will reboot so you can use it in normal mode. You can now get ready to clash a custom recovery image to learn how to flash a custom ROM, or you can head directly to Google Play and download the apps that need root access.
